Martha Gehman (born 1955) is an American actress and acting coach, perhaps best known for her role as Ophelia in the 1985 cult classic The Legend of Billie Jean.[1][2]

She also had supporting roles in The Flamingo Kid,[3] F/X, Threesome and A Kiss Before Dying.

Gehman has a twin sister, Abbie, and is the daughter of actress Estelle Parsons and Richard Gehman.[4] Her nephew is football player Eben Britton.
